Description

A recently updated stone built 2 bedroom mid terrace offering a lovely cosy home. The property benefits from all new carpets installed, fully redecorated, gas combi central heating and full uPVC double glazing. Accommodation comprises of entrance hallway, lounge with feature bay window and Inglenook fireplace with log burner, kitchen/diner with cooking appliance, rear lobby/utility room. To the first floor are two double sized bedrooms and a bathroom suite with separate shower cubicle. Council Tax Band A, EPC TBC.

REFERENCE AND CREDIT CHECK

A holding deposit equal to 1 weeks rent is payable upon the start of your application.
Successful Applicants - any holding deposit will be offset against the initial rent or deposit, with the agreement of the payee.

Under the Tenant Fee Act 2019: The Holding Deposit will become non-refundable, should you fail your reference and credit checks, if you provide misleading information or fail to declare a county court judgement (CCJ) or an (IVA) on your application form or the nominated guarantor application form. We allow up to 15 days for all checks to be completed. Should you have any concerns regarding these checks, please notify a member of staff before you make payment.

Tenant(s) minimum yearly income affordability to pass the credit check is calculated at 2.5 times the yearly rent.
(Example: Rent of £600 PCM x 12 = £7,200 x 2.5 = £18,000) This minimum income can be shared on a joint tenancy only.

Working Guarantor minimum yearly income affordability to pass the credit check is calculated at 3 times the yearly rent.
(Example: Rent of £600 PCM x 12 = £7,200 x 3 = £21,600) (Or hold savings or pension(s) equal or more than this amount)

Please note: if you are claiming basic or basic Universal Credit, or your employment is on a zero hour's contract or your employment position is temporary, you will require a guarantor in a permanent contract of employment.
